A Gift of Winter

In a few days, we will officially enter the season of winter. In winter we feel it is acceptable to be quieter.  We stay inside  because weather conditions are often harsh (unless we live in milder climates).  Winter is a perfect season to make more time for ourselves. We  have permission to rest more and to snuggle in earlier because it’s cold and dark out. 

Curling up by the fire with a good book is a wonderful image. Yet,  taking care of ourselves and making more discretionary time available is something we can bring into the remainder of the year as well. It’s a choice we make, and one that affects the quality of our wellbeing, just like choosing to take a certain amount of our income and pay ourselves/savings before we pay anyone else. 

Each contribution brings large dividends later because we have taken care of the basics first. When we leave winter, let’s not leave ourselves behind for the next 9 months. Let’s make time for wellbeing in different forms that reflect each season and contribute to the quality of our lives.
